Compare the direct costs to the consumer of using a succession of ten 100 W incandescent light bulbs with an efficiency to visible light of 5%, a lifetime of 1,000 h, and a price of 50 cents with one compact fluorescent lamp giving the same illumination at 22% efficiency, a lifetime of 10,000 h, and a price of $3. Assume a price of electricity of 10 cents per kWh.
